Transaction 758b31f13f16c138856f1e1baf7c4a1ab0c00cccfd5be07e3649380269ee3e9e
1 Input
2 Outputs
- 758b31f13f16c138856f1e1baf7c4a1ab0c00cccfd5be07e3649380269ee3e9e:0
- 758b31f13f16c138856f1e1baf7c4a1ab0c00cccfd5be07e3649380269ee3e9e:1
value 57660000
address 1E7jPebBKr6WW1e2B4WhQAh51WADFDjXym
value 488275191
address 1GruZSC9dbhcjHVBZ46XFvG5XhHuGbP7gk